Negative Words to Describe Artist

  1. Pretentious: Attempting to impress by affecting greater importance or talent than is possessed.
  2. Derivative: Lacking originality; imitating the work of another artist without adding a new or unique perspective.
  3. Inconsistent: Showing a lack of uniformity or steadiness in quality or performance in their artistic work.
  4. Obscure: Difficult to understand or unclear, often leaving the audience puzzled or unengaged.
  5. Pedestrian: Lacking inspiration or excitement; dull or commonplace in their artistic approach.
  6. Repetitive: Using the same elements or themes excessively, leading to a lack of originality or freshness.
  7. Superficial: Concerned only with the obvious or apparent, lacking depth in their artistic expression.
  8. Tedious: Too long, slow, or dull; tiresome or monotonous in their artistic process or output.
  9. Vague: Not clearly or explicitly stated or expressed, leading to ambiguity in their artwork.
  10. Ephemeral: Lasting for a very short time, making the artistic impact fleeting and not enduring.
  11. Frivolous: Not having any serious purpose or value in their artistic endeavors.
  12. Indulgent: Overly lenient with oneself; creating art that is excessively self-centered or self-gratifying.
  13. Monotonous: Dull and repetitious; lacking in variety and interest in their artwork.
  14. Uninspired: Lacking in imagination or originality, leading to art that feels stale or derivative.
  15. Clichéd: Relying on overused themes, styles, or elements, resulting in art that lacks freshness or originality.

Catchy Words to Describe Artist

  1. Trailblazer: An artist who pioneers new techniques, styles, or concepts, leading the way in the art world.
  2. Maverick: An independent-minded artist who refuses to conform to the conventions or rules of the art community.
  3. Virtuoso: An artist with exceptional skill and technique, often seen as a genius in their field.
  4. Enigma: An artist whose work is mysterious, puzzling, or difficult to understand, yet fascinating.
  5. Chameleon: An artist who can adapt their style to suit different subjects or mediums, showing great versatility.
  6. Firebrand: An artist known for their passionate and provocative work, often sparking debate or controversy.
  7. Alchemist: An artist who can transform ordinary materials into something extraordinary through their creative process.
  8. Connoisseur: An artist with a deep understanding and appreciation for the finer details of their craft.
  9. Sage: An artist who brings wisdom, insight, and depth to their work, often reflecting on life’s bigger questions.
  10. Voyager: An artist whose work explores new territories, ideas, or themes, taking the audience on a journey.
  11. Maestro: An artist who is a master of their craft, commanding respect and admiration for their skill and leadership.
  12. Pioneer: An artist who is among the first to explore new realms or techniques in the art world.
  13. Sculptor: Used metaphorically for an artist who shapes and molds their work with precision and intention.
  14. Dreamer: An artist who brings their vivid imagination and fantastical ideas to life through their creations.
  15. Oracle: An artist whose work provides deep insight, often foreseeing trends or expressing profound truths.
